People looking for work and businesses seeking to recruit are being invited to attend the Connecting Barnstaple Careers and Jobs Fair at the town Pannier Market on Thursday, June 5.
The free event has been organised by Barnstaple Town Council and One Barnstaple, working with the Department for Work and Pensions, North Devon Council, Barnstaple Pannier Market and Flourishing Barnstaple.
It will run from 10am to 2pm and is designed to bring together local employers and job seekers.
People attending will be able to meet with employers who are actively recruiting, learn about job opportunities and career pathways, network with organisations across a variety of sectors and access advice and support.
Employers who wish to exhibit at the event need to get in touch with the DWP by Monday, June 2 via the email address below.
Ella McCann, community developer for One Barnstaple said; “This is a fantastic opportunity for attendees to meet with a wide range of employers and discover new possibilities across various sectors.”
Amber Jenkins from the DWP added: “The fair will provide a valuable platform for making connections, exploring career opportunities and supporting local employment.
“Whether you’re looking for work or offering employment opportunities, we would love to see you there.”
The Mayor of Barnstaple, Councillor Janet Coates said the event reflected a commitment to supporting the community and ensuring everyone has access to opportunities.
